🛬 Runways
| Designator | Length | Width | Surface | Lighted |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 01/19 | 8,500 ft (2,591 m) | 150 ft (46 m) | ASP | 💡 Yes |
| 10/28 | 7,200 ft (2,195 m) | 150 ft (46 m) | ASP | 💡 Yes |
